Essential Plugins for Automating WordPress
The WordPress community offers a myriad of plugins that simplify automation. Here are some essential ones:
1. WP All Import
This plugin allows the import of any XML or CSV file for automatic content creation. For instance, if you’re managing a site with regularly updated data (like real estate listings), you can automate the process of importing new listings without manual involvement.
2. Zapier for WordPress
Zapier is a powerful automation tool that connects apps and services, including WordPress. You can set up Zaps to share new posts across social media or automatically subscribe users to newsletters when they register on your site.
3. WP Mail SMTP
A reliable email setup is crucial for any site. This plugin automates your email delivery process, ensuring that notifications and newsletters are sent without you worrying about them getting lost in spam filters.
Leveraging n8n for Advanced Automation
While plugins can cover many bases, using n8n can elevate your automation strategy to the next level. n8n is an open-source workflow automation tool that allows you to create more complex automation workflows across various applications, including WordPress. Let’s explore how to get started.
Setting Up n8n
First, install n8n following the instructions on the official website. Once you have n8n up and running:
- Create a New Workflow: Begin by creating a new workflow to define your automation sequence.
- Add WordPress Node: Use the WordPress node from the n8n nodes library. This node allows you to perform various actions like creating or retrieving posts.
- Connect Other Services: n8n supports integrating various other applications such as Google Sheets, Slack, and email services, enabling you to create versatile workflows.
Example Workflow: Automated Content Posting
Suppose you want to automate your blog posting from a Google Sheet:
- Use a Google Sheets trigger to detect new rows in your spreadsheet.
- Configure the WordPress node to create a new post each time a row is added.
- Optionally, add steps to format the content or even share the post on social media automatically.
Best Practices for Automation
Here are some best practices to ensure your automation strategies yield the best results:
- Start Small: Begin by automating simple tasks before tackling more complex workflows.
- Test Your Automation: Always test automations to ensure they work correctly without errors. Monitor the outcomes frequently.
- Document Your Workflows: Keep records of the automation processes you create. This documentation will help you understand and troubleshoot future issues quickly.
